- 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
UML框式图设计方案及制度
一、UML框式图设计方案概述
UML(统一建模语言)框式图,也称为用例图或系统上下文图,是描述系统功能、组件及其相互关系的重要工具。本方案旨在通过UML框式图的设计与应用,实现系统建模的标准化、规范化,提升系统设计的清晰度和可维护性。以下是UML框式图设计方案的具体内容。
二、UML框式图设计原则
(一)标准化原则
1.统一命名规范:所有UML框式图元素应遵循统一的命名规则,确保图示清晰易懂。
2.符号一致性:遵循UML标准符号,确保图示在不同场景下具有一致性。
(二)简洁性原则
1.突出重点:避免过度复杂,聚焦于系统核心功能与组件关系。
2.图文并茂:合理运用注释和标签,提高图示可读性。
(三)可扩展性原则
1.模块化设计:将系统划分为多个模块,便于后续扩展和维护。
2.参数化设计:预留参数接口,支持功能扩展。
三、UML框式图设计步骤
(一)需求分析
1.收集系统需求:通过访谈、调研等方式,收集用户需求。
2.确定系统边界:明确系统功能范围,界定系统边界。
(二)系统建模
1.绘制用例图:根据需求,绘制系统用例图,展示系统功能。
2.绘制组件图:将系统划分为多个组件,绘制组件图,展示组件间关系。
(三)验证与优化
1.内部评审:组织内部专家对UML框式图进行评审,确保设计合理性。
2.用户反馈:收集用户反馈,对UML框式图进行优化。
四、UML框式图设计应用
(一)项目管理
1.任务分解:将系统功能分解为多个任务,便于项目管理。
2.进度跟踪:通过UML框式图,实时跟踪项目进度。
(二)团队协作
1.沟通工具:作为团队沟通工具,提高团队协作效率。
2.知识传承:作为系统设计文档,便于新成员快速了解系统。
(三)系统维护
1.故障排查:通过UML框式图,快速定位故障点。
2.功能扩展:为系统功能扩展提供依据。
五、UML框式图设计案例
(一)案例背景
某企业计划开发一套ERP系统,用于管理企业内部资源。为提高系统设计质量,采用UML框式图进行系统建模。
(二)设计过程
1.需求分析:收集企业需求,确定系统边界。
2.系统建模:绘制用例图和组件图,展示系统功能与组件关系。
3.验证与优化:组织内部评审,根据反馈进行优化。
(三)设计成果
1.用例图:展示了ERP系统的核心功能,如采购管理、库存管理、销售管理等。
2.组件图:将系统划分为多个组件,如数据库组件、业务逻辑组件、用户界面组件等。
六、总结
UML框式图设计方案通过标准化、简洁性和可扩展性原则,实现了系统建模的规范化,提高了系统设计的清晰度和可维护性。在实际应用中,UML框式图设计方案在项目管理、团队协作和系统维护等方面发挥了重要作用。通过案例分析,展示了UML框式图设计方案的具体实施过程和成果,为类似项目提供了参考。
一、UML框式图设计方案概述
UML(统一建模语言)框式图,也称为用例图或系统上下文图,是描述系统功能、组件及其相互关系的重要工具。本方案旨在通过UML框式图的设计与应用,实现系统建模的标准化、规范化,提升系统设计的清晰度和可维护性。以下是UML框式图设计方案的具体内容。
二、UML框式图设计原则
(一)标准化原则
1.统一命名规范:所有UML框式图元素应遵循统一的命名规则,确保图示清晰易懂。具体要求包括:
(1)类名:使用大写字母开头的驼峰命名法,例如`UserAccount`。
(2)用例名:使用动名词短语,例如`RegisterUser`。
(3)接口名:使用大写字母开头的驼峰命名法,并在名称后加`Interface`,例如`PaymentProcessingInterface`。
2.符号一致性:遵循UML标准符号,确保图示在不同场景下具有一致性。具体要求包括:
(1)类图:使用矩形表示类,分为三个部分:类名、属性、方法。
(2)用例图:使用椭圆形表示用例,使用直线表示用例与参与者之间的关系。
(3)组件图:使用矩形表示组件,并在矩形内部标注组件名称。
(二)简洁性原则
1.突出重点:避免过度复杂,聚焦于系统核心功能与组件关系。具体要求包括:
(1)只展示关键类和用例,避免展示无关的类和用例。
(2)使用简化的线条和符号,避免使用过多的装饰和细节。
2.图文并茂:合理运用注释和标签,提高图示可读性。具体要求包括:
(1)在图示中添加注释,解释关键元素的含义和作用。
(2)使用标签标注关键关系,例如`1`表示一对一关系,``表示多对多关系。
(三)可扩展性原则
1.模块化设计:将系统划分为多个模块,便于后续扩展和维护。具体要求包括:
(1)将系统划分为多个子系统,每个子系统负责一部分功能。
(2)在子系统之间定义清晰的接口,便
有哪些信誉好的足球投注网站
文档评论(0)